Syrian president accuses Turkey of aggression as Iran attempts to ease tension

STORY: Syrian president accuses Turkey of aggression as Iran attempts to ease tension DATELINE: July 3, 2022 LENGTH: 00:00:58 LOCATION: Damascus CATEGORY: POLITICS SHOTLIST: 1. various of meeting between Syrian President Bashar al-Assad and Iranian Foreign Minister Hossein Amir Abdollahian (Syrian Presidency) STORYLINE: Syrian President Bashar al-Assad on Saturday accused the Turkish leadership of committing aggression against Syria, even as Turkey is planning a new offensive in northern Syria. His remarks came during a meeting with visiting Iranian Foreign Minister Hossein Amir-Abdollahian who arrived in Damascus earlier in the day mainly to ease the tension between Syria and Turkey. The pretexts Turkey uses to justify its aggression on Syrian territory are "false, misleading, and have nothing to do with reality," Assad was quoted by the state SANA news agency as saying.
